About the Role
We are looking for Render's first Forward Deployed Engineer to work hands-on with our most strategic customers. Our largest contracts and fastest-growing AI startups are scaling on Render, and this role provides them with a dedicated, concierge-level technical partnership. You will balance two motions: white-glove engagement with our top accounts, where you work closely with the customer's engineering team as a trusted technical partner, and scoped onboarding intensives that get high-growth startups confidently building on the platform. As the first FDE in our Field Engineering organization, you will define the playbook for this function, prove the model, and shape how it scales.
What You'll Do
Work closely with Render's top accounts as their dedicated technical partner, providing concierge service across architecture reviews, migration planning, and hands-on delivery.
Run scoped onboarding intensives for high-growth startups, from intake and success criteria through hands-on-keyboard execution.
Lead the database side of customer engagements, including Postgres architecture, performance tuning, and complex data migrations from Heroku, AWS, and other cloud providers.
Drive activation and expansion in strategic accounts: turn major credit grants into durable production adoption, surface expansion signals from your technical work, and partner with the account team to convert them into revenue.
Own the ongoing technical relationship for your accounts: proactive architecture and health reviews, collaborative roadmap sessions, incident follow-up and RCA, and escalation point for hard technical problems, working closely with the account team.
Build the FDE playbook: qualification criteria, engagement templates, success metrics, and reference architectures that make the program repeatable.
Act as a high-signal feedback channel to product and engineering, translating customer friction into prioritized product input.
Partner with Account Managers and Customer Engineers to ensure smooth handoffs after each engagement and durable long-term coverage.
What We're Looking For
8+ years in a hands-on, customer-facing engineering role: forward deployed, solutions, customer, or professional services engineering.
Strong software engineering fundamentals; you can write production-quality code and work hands-on-keyboard inside a customer's codebase.
Deep experience with cloud infrastructure: containers, CI/CD, networking, autoscaling, and running real workloads in production.
Deep Postgres and database expertise: schema design, performance tuning, replication, and production data migrations. Our largest engagements consistently turn on this skill set.
AI fluency: you work with AI tools daily to accelerate your own delivery, and you understand LLM application architectures well enough to guide the teams building them.
Excellent communication with everyone from startup founders to enterprise platform teams, including executive-level conversations.
Self-directed and comfortable with ambiguity; you can stand up a new function without an existing playbook.
Commercial instincts: you understand how technical wins connect to expansion, renewal, and revenue.
Nice-to-Haves
Migration experience from Heroku, AWS, or other clouds onto modern platforms.
Hands-on experience shipping AI and LLM applications (RAG pipelines, agent frameworks, inference workloads); many of our fastest-growing accounts are AI-native.
Prior experience as the first hire in a role or a founding member of a new program.
